The increasing demand on streaming data processing has motivated the study of providing Quality of Service (QoS) for data stream processing. Especially for mission-critical applications, deterministic QoS requirements are always desired in order for the results to be useful. However, the best-effort QoS providing of most existing data stream systems would bring about considerable uncertainty to the query results. This paper attempts to provide a new insight into the problem of providing QoS guarantee for continuous queries over streams. Based on the proposed QoS model of stream processing, a QoS guaranteeing scheduling algorithm is proposed. Experimental results are presented to characterize the efficiency and effectiveness of our approaches.
